## **Key Features**
### **1. Neoprene Insulation for Warmth**
One of the standout features of these waders is the **neoprene insulation**, which provides excellent warmth in cold water conditions. Whether you’re wading through icy streams or fishing in early spring, the 3.5mm neoprene material ensures heat retention without excessive bulkiness. This makes the waders suitable for year-round use, particularly in cooler climates.
### **2. Durable Rubber Construction**
The **rubberized outer shell** enhances durability, protecting against abrasions from rocks, branches, and rough terrain. Unlike some PVC or nylon waders that may puncture easily, the reinforced rubber design minimizes the risk of leaks, ensuring long-term use.
### **3. Camouflage Design**
The **camo pattern** is ideal for hunters and anglers who prefer stealth. The natural camouflage helps blend into the surroundings, reducing the chance of spooking fish or game. This feature is particularly useful for fly fishing or duck hunting in shallow waters.
### **4. Adjustable Frogg Togg Suspenders**
The included **Frogg Togg suspenders** add comfort and adjustability. They help distribute the weight of the waders evenly across the shoulders, reducing strain during long fishing trips. The quick-release buckles also make it easy to put on or remove the waders when needed.
### **5. Secure Seams and Reinforced Knees**
The **double-stitched seams** and **reinforced knee pads** enhance durability, preventing tears in high-stress areas. This is especially beneficial for anglers who frequently kneel on rocky riverbeds.
## **Performance in the Field**
### **Comfort and Fit**
The **Size 12** option accommodates a wide range of body types, and the neoprene material offers a snug yet flexible fit. However, some users have noted that sizing can be slightly inconsistent, so checking the manufacturer’s size chart before purchasing is advisable.
### **Waterproofing and Breathability**
While the rubber construction ensures waterproofing, breathability is somewhat limited compared to modern breathable fabric waders. This means they may feel slightly clammy during extended use in warmer weather. However, for cold-water fishing, this is less of an issue.
### **Mobility and Ease of Movement**
The waders provide good mobility, allowing for easy walking and wading. The suspenders prevent sagging, and the reinforced knees offer extra protection when navigating uneven terrain.
